To quote Zach Strief from Sports Talk on WWL yesterday "Anyone who thinks Drew Brees is done is either uneducated about football or blind."
Exactly. Drew has honestly played some of his best ball the past two years. Super efficient. Tremendous TD:INT ratio. Super accurate. Yes, he can not push the ball down the field with consistency like he could in the past. Yes, he did not have a good game and made some costly mistakes in the playoff loss, but that was a team loss and everyone has bad games, even the all time greats.

Yes, Sean, Drew and the entire organization need to make adjustments for next year to remain competitive and ultimately compete for the super bowl. Run game needs to be more consistent. Deep routes need to be a viable threat to keep defenses honest (with Taysom, better "WR2" play, or otherwise). The defense needs to be able to close out games and not give up back-breaking plays in the final minutes and seconds of games.

But how anyone can say Drew being on the team, having played some of his best football, despite his physical limitations due to age, does not give the Saints the best chance to win next year is beyond me.

Although at this point the Saints obviously need to think long-term and about life after Brees, the number of Saints fans who would like to push the greatest player to ever wear the black and gold out the door, despite him playing at a very high level still, blows my mind. Let's not be so quick to throw out one of the greatest QBs of all time, especially while he is still playing at a very high level.

The time for life after Brees will come. I'm all for incorporating Taysom in more and would love if the fantasy-land Burrow trade (Hello, Swimmer) could come to fruition. But I truly believe having Brees on this team for 2020 still gives us the best chance to win. Enjoy the ride.
